Is Virgin Galactic Holdings, Inc (SPCE) a Good Investment?

Claude

Virgin Galactic faces critical financial distress with revenue collapsing 78% YoY to just $227K, indicating failed or severely constrained commercial spaceflight operations. Negative free cash flow of -$93.3M combined with Debt/Equity of 1.43x and negative interest coverage creates unsustainable cash burn with estimated runway under 18 months. The company requires immediate capital restructuring to survive.

SPCE Stock Risks: Virgin Galactic Holdings, Inc Investment Risks

Claude
  • ! Revenue collapsed 78% YoY to $227K indicating commercial spaceflight operations are near non-operational
  • ! Negative free cash flow of -$93.3M annually is fundamentally unsustainable without capital infusion or rapid revenue recovery
  • ! Debt/Equity of 1.43x with negative interest coverage ratio of -20.3x signals high financial distress
  • ! Current ratio of 1.00x and Quick ratio of 0.95x indicate extremely tight working capital with minimal flexibility
  • ! Negative operating cash flow of -$53.5M coupled with $39.8M capex creates <18 month cash runway at current burn

SPCE Revenue & Earnings Growth: 5-Year Financial Trend

SPCE 5-year financial data: Year 2021: Revenue $3.8M, Net Income -$215.1M, EPS $-1.11. Year 2022: Revenue $3.3M, Net Income -$644.9M, EPS $-2.94. Year 2023: Revenue $6.8M, Net Income -$352.9M, EPS $-1.43. Year 2024: Revenue $7.0M, Net Income -$502.3M, EPS $-29.79. Year 2025: Revenue $7.0M, Net Income -$346.7M, EPS $-13.89.
